Ethical Considerations in Process Mining Research

Chapter: Process Mining Research Trends and Future Directions

Introduction:
Process mining is a rapidly evolving field that focuses on analyzing event data to uncover, monitor, and improve real-world processes. In this chapter, we will discuss the key challenges faced in process mining research, the key learnings from these challenges, and their solutions. We will also explore the emerging technologies in process mining and the ethical considerations that researchers need to keep in mind. Additionally, we will highlight the modern trends in process mining research.

Key Challenges in Process Mining Research:
1. Data Quality: One of the key challenges in process mining research is the quality of data. Event logs can contain errors, missing data, or inconsistencies, which can lead to inaccurate process models. Researchers need to develop techniques to clean and preprocess the data to ensure its reliability.

Solution: Researchers can employ data cleansing techniques such as outlier detection, data imputation, and data validation to enhance the quality of event logs. Additionally, collaboration with domain experts can help in identifying and resolving data quality issues.

2. Scalability: Process mining involves analyzing large volumes of event data, which can pose scalability challenges. Traditional process mining algorithms may not be able to handle the complexity and size of real-world event logs.

Solution: Researchers can explore parallel and distributed processing techniques to improve the scalability of process mining algorithms. Utilizing cloud computing resources and developing efficient data storage and retrieval mechanisms can also help in addressing scalability challenges.

3. Privacy and Security: Process mining often involves the analysis of sensitive data, such as personal information or trade secrets. Maintaining privacy and ensuring data security is crucial in process mining research.

Solution: Researchers should adopt privacy-preserving techniques such as anonymization, encryption, and access control to protect sensitive data. Compliance with data protection regulations and obtaining informed consent from data subjects are essential ethical considerations.

4. Process Discovery: Discovering accurate and meaningful process models from event data is a fundamental challenge in process mining. The complexity and variability of real-world processes make it difficult to identify the underlying process structure.

Solution: Researchers can develop advanced process discovery algorithms that can handle complex process behaviors, exceptions, and variations. Techniques like process abstraction, conformance checking, and clustering can aid in improving the accuracy of process models.

5. Process Enhancement: Once a process model is discovered, the next challenge is to identify process improvement opportunities. Process mining research needs to focus on developing techniques to enhance process efficiency, effectiveness, and compliance.

Solution: Researchers can employ process enhancement techniques such as bottleneck analysis, resource allocation optimization, and compliance checking. Utilizing machine learning and predictive analytics can also help in identifying process improvement opportunities.

6. Real-time Process Mining: Traditional process mining techniques are often applied to historical event data. However, there is a growing need for real-time process mining to enable proactive decision-making and process monitoring.

Solution: Researchers can explore streaming data processing techniques and develop real-time process mining algorithms. Integration with real-time data sources and event stream processing platforms can enable continuous process monitoring and analysis.

7. Domain-specific Challenges: Process mining research needs to address the unique challenges posed by different domains, such as healthcare, finance, or manufacturing. Each domain has specific process characteristics and requirements that need to be considered.

Solution: Researchers should collaborate with domain experts to understand the domain-specific challenges and develop tailored process mining techniques. Customization of algorithms, data preprocessing steps, and visualization approaches can help in addressing domain-specific requirements.

8. Interpretability and Explainability: Process mining algorithms often generate complex process models that may be difficult to interpret and explain to stakeholders. Ensuring interpretability and explainability is crucial for gaining trust and acceptance.

Solution: Researchers can focus on developing visualization techniques and interactive tools that facilitate the interpretation and explanation of process models. Providing contextual information, highlighting critical process paths, and incorporating user feedback can enhance the interpretability of process mining results.

9. Integration with Other Technologies: Process mining can benefit from the integration with other emerging technologies such as machine learning, artificial intelligence, and blockchain. However, the integration poses technical and conceptual challenges.

Solution: Researchers should explore the synergies between process mining and other technologies to develop hybrid approaches. Integration with machine learning algorithms for predictive process monitoring, AI techniques for automated decision-making, and blockchain for secure process data storage can lead to novel research directions.

10. Adoption and Implementation: The adoption and implementation of process mining techniques in real-world organizations can be challenging. Resistance to change, lack of awareness, and organizational barriers can hinder the successful deployment of process mining solutions.

Solution: Researchers need to collaborate with industry partners and conduct case studies to demonstrate the value of process mining in different domains. Developing user-friendly tools, providing training and education programs, and showcasing successful process mining implementations can help in driving adoption.

Key Learnings and Solutions:
1. Data quality is crucial for accurate process mining results. Employ data cleansing techniques and collaborate with domain experts to enhance data quality.
2. Scalability can be improved through parallel and distributed processing techniques and efficient data storage mechanisms.
3. Ensure privacy and data security by adopting privacy-preserving techniques and complying with data protection regulations.
4. Develop advanced process discovery algorithms to handle complex process behaviors and variations.
5. Employ process enhancement techniques such as bottleneck analysis and resource allocation optimization to improve process efficiency.
6. Explore real-time process mining techniques to enable proactive decision-making and continuous process monitoring.
7. Collaborate with domain experts to address the unique challenges posed by different domains.
8. Focus on developing visualization techniques and interactive tools to enhance the interpretability of process mining results.
9. Explore the integration of process mining with other emerging technologies to develop hybrid approaches.
10. Drive adoption by collaborating with industry partners, conducting case studies, and showcasing successful implementations.

Related Modern Trends in Process Mining Research:
1. Explainable Process Mining: Focus on developing process mining techniques that provide interpretable and explainable results.
2. Process Mining for Robotic Process Automation: Integration of process mining with robotic process automation to improve process automation initiatives.
3. Process Mining in Healthcare: Application of process mining in healthcare settings to improve patient care and operational efficiency.
4. Process Mining for Customer Journey Analysis: Utilization of process mining techniques to analyze customer journeys and improve customer experience.
5. Process Mining for Cybersecurity: Application of process mining in cybersecurity to detect and prevent malicious activities.
6. Process Mining in Supply Chain Management: Utilization of process mining to optimize supply chain processes and improve logistics.
7. Process Mining for Compliance Monitoring: Application of process mining techniques to ensure compliance with regulations and policies.
8. Process Mining in Industry 4.0: Integration of process mining with Industry 4.0 technologies to enable smart manufacturing and process optimization.
9. Process Mining for Business Process Outsourcing: Utilization of process mining to improve the efficiency and effectiveness of outsourced processes.
10. Process Mining in Financial Services: Application of process mining in the financial sector to enhance risk management and fraud detection.

Best Practices in Resolving or Speeding Up Process Mining Research:

Innovation:
1. Foster a culture of innovation by encouraging researchers to think outside the box and explore novel approaches.
2. Promote interdisciplinary collaboration to leverage diverse expertise and perspectives.
3. Regularly review and update research methodologies to incorporate the latest advancements.

Technology:
1. Stay updated with the latest technological advancements in process mining and related fields.
2. Utilize open-source tools and platforms to facilitate collaboration and knowledge sharing.
3. Experiment with emerging technologies such as AI, machine learning, and blockchain to enhance process mining capabilities.

Process:
1. Follow a systematic and iterative research process, including problem formulation, data collection, analysis, and validation.
2. Document research methodologies and findings to ensure reproducibility and transparency.
3. Continuously improve research processes based on feedback and lessons learned.

Invention:
1. Encourage researchers to develop innovative algorithms, techniques, and tools to address process mining challenges.
2. Protect intellectual property through patents, copyrights, or open-source licensing, depending on the research objectives.
3. Collaborate with industry partners to translate research inventions into practical applications.

Education and Training:
1. Provide training and education programs to researchers, industry professionals, and students to enhance process mining skills and knowledge.
2. Foster collaboration between academia and industry through internships, joint research projects, and knowledge transfer programs.
3. Develop online learning resources and courses to reach a wider audience and promote continuous learning.

Content and Data:
1. Publish research findings in reputable journals and conferences to disseminate knowledge and contribute to the academic community.
2. Share research data and code to facilitate replication, verification, and collaboration.
3. Utilize diverse and representative datasets to ensure the generalizability and applicability of research findings.

Key Metrics Relevant to Process Mining Research:

1. Accuracy: Measure the accuracy of process mining results by comparing discovered process models with ground truth models or expert knowledge.
2. Scalability: Evaluate the scalability of process mining algorithms by measuring their performance on large-scale event logs.
3. Efficiency: Assess the efficiency of process mining techniques by measuring the time and computational resources required for analysis.
4. Precision and Recall: Measure the precision and recall of process discovery algorithms by comparing the discovered models with the actual process behavior.
5. Conformance: Evaluate the conformance of process models with event data to assess their fitness and adherence to real-world processes.
6. Robustness: Measure the robustness of process mining algorithms by evaluating their performance on noisy or incomplete event logs.
7. Interpretability: Assess the interpretability of process mining results by conducting user studies or expert evaluations.
8. Impact: Measure the impact of process mining research by evaluating its adoption, implementation, and benefits in real-world organizations.
9. Privacy Preservation: Assess the effectiveness of privacy-preserving techniques by measuring the level of privacy achieved while maintaining data utility.
10. User Satisfaction: Measure user satisfaction with process mining tools and techniques through surveys, interviews, or usability studies.

In conclusion, process mining research faces various challenges related to data quality, scalability, privacy, and interpretability. However, by adopting innovative approaches, leveraging emerging technologies, and following best practices, researchers can overcome these challenges and drive the future directions of process mining. The key learnings from these challenges and the related modern trends discussed in this chapter provide valuable insights for researchers and practitioners in the field of process mining.

Leave a Comment

Your email address will not be published. Required fields are marked *

Shopping Cart
error: Content cannot be copied. it is protected !!
Scroll to Top